The Qwirkle game helps kids with learning pattern recognition and strategic planning. The layout of the game is comparable to dominoes since you connect blocks with similar shapes and colors to make a table filled with different tiles. Players earn points by matching tiles with the same attributes and earn around six points, called a “qwirkle”, if they line up six tiles with matching attributes. Google Earth lets kids explore the entire world virtually with maps, landmarks, and 3D views. Kids can take virtual tours of historical sites, ecosystems, and different cultures. It makes geography and science lessons exciting by bringing the planet to their fingertips.
